Material Matters: Understanding Pot Types

Pots come in a variety of materials, each with its own set of advantages and disadvantages. The material affects drainage, water retention, and even the aesthetic appeal of your plants. Choosing the right material depends on your plant’s needs and your personal preferences. Let’s explore some common pot materials:

  • Terracotta: Terracotta pots are a classic choice, known for their porous nature. This porosity allows for excellent drainage and air circulation, making them ideal for plants that prefer drier soil. They are also relatively inexpensive and provide a rustic look. However, terracotta pots can dry out quickly, requiring more frequent watering, especially in hot weather.
  • Plastic: Plastic pots are lightweight, durable, and come in a wide range of colors and styles. They retain moisture better than terracotta, making them suitable for plants that prefer consistently moist soil. Plastic pots are also generally less expensive. However, they may not drain as well as terracotta and can trap heat, potentially harming plant roots.
  • Ceramic: Ceramic pots are glazed, making them less porous than terracotta. They come in various designs and are often more decorative. The glazing helps retain moisture, so they’re suitable for plants that prefer slightly moist soil. Ensure the ceramic pot has adequate drainage holes.
  • Concrete: Concrete pots are heavy and durable, offering excellent stability, especially for larger plants. They provide good insulation and can withstand various weather conditions. Concrete pots are also aesthetically pleasing. However, they can be porous and may require sealing to prevent water absorption and cracking in freezing temperatures.
  • Metal: Metal pots can be stylish but can also heat up in the sun. This heat can be detrimental to the plant roots. Ensure the metal pot is made from a rust-resistant material and has drainage holes.

Size and Shape: Finding the Perfect Fit

The size and shape of the pot should complement your plant’s size and root system. A pot that’s too small will restrict growth, while a pot that’s too large can lead to overwatering and root rot. Consider the following factors:

  • Plant Size: Choose a pot that is large enough to accommodate the plant’s current size and its anticipated growth. As a general rule, select a pot that is a few inches wider than the root ball.
  • Root System: Consider the type of root system your plant has. Plants with shallow roots do well in wider, shallower pots, while plants with deep roots require taller pots.
  • Shape: Round pots are generally versatile, while square or rectangular pots can be space-efficient. The shape should also complement the plant’s overall appearance.
  • Drainage Holes: Ensure that the pot has sufficient drainage holes to allow excess water to escape. Multiple drainage holes are preferable to a single large one.

Drainage Hole Considerations: Essential for Plant Health

Drainage holes are the unsung heroes of container gardening. They prevent water from accumulating in the pot, which can lead to root rot and other problems. Always ensure your pot has adequate drainage holes. If a pot doesn’t have drainage holes, you can often drill them yourself, but be careful not to damage the pot.

  • Number of Holes: More drainage holes generally mean better drainage. Look for pots with multiple holes, especially for plants that are sensitive to overwatering.
  • Hole Size: The size of the drainage holes should be sufficient to allow water to drain freely.
  • Placement: Drainage holes are typically located at the bottom of the pot, but some pots may have them along the sides near the bottom.
  • Covering the Holes: To prevent soil from escaping through the drainage holes, you can cover them with mesh, broken pottery shards, or landscape fabric. This will ensure proper drainage while keeping the soil in the pot.

Understanding Potting Mix vs. Garden Soil

Potting mix and garden soil are not interchangeable. Garden soil is typically denser and compacts easily, which restricts airflow and drainage in a pot. Potting mix, on the other hand, is specifically formulated for container gardening. It is typically a soilless mix, which means it doesn’t contain actual soil, but rather a blend of ingredients designed to provide optimal growing conditions.   • Potting Mix: Potting mix is lightweight, well-draining, and provides good aeration. It typically contains a mix of ingredients such as peat moss or coco coir, perlite, vermiculite, and sometimes compost or other amendments.
  • Garden Soil: Garden soil is heavy, compacts easily, and doesn’t drain well in pots. It is best used in the ground where it can benefit from the surrounding soil structure and natural drainage.

Types of Potting Mixes and Their Uses

There are various types of potting mixes available, each formulated for different plant types and needs. Choosing the right mix can significantly impact your plant’s health. Consider the following types:

  • All-Purpose Potting Mix: This is a general-purpose mix suitable for a wide variety of plants. It typically contains peat moss or coco coir, perlite, and sometimes vermiculite.
  • Seed Starting Mix: Seed starting mixes are finely textured and designed for delicate seedlings. They typically contain peat moss or coco coir, vermiculite, and perlite.
  • Cactus and Succulent Mix: Cactus and succulent mixes are formulated for plants that require excellent drainage. They typically contain a higher proportion of perlite, pumice, or sand.
  • Orchid Mix: Orchid mixes are designed for orchids and other epiphytes. They typically contain bark, sphagnum moss, and other coarse materials.
  • African Violet Mix: African violet mixes are specifically formulated for African violets and other plants that prefer slightly acidic soil.

Amending Potting Mix: Enhancing Soil Quality

While potting mix is a good starting point, you can amend it to improve drainage, aeration, and nutrient content. Amending your soil can provide an extra boost to plant health. Consider these amendments:

  • Perlite: Perlite is a volcanic glass that improves drainage and aeration.
  • Vermiculite: Vermiculite helps retain moisture and nutrients.
  • Compost: Compost adds nutrients and improves soil structure.
  • Coco Coir: Coco coir is a sustainable alternative to peat moss that improves water retention and aeration.
  • Slow-Release Fertilizer: Slow-release fertilizers provide a steady supply of nutrients over time.

Preparing the Pot: Ensuring Proper Drainage

Before planting, you need to prepare the pot to ensure proper drainage and prevent soil from escaping. This simple step can prevent soil loss.

  1. Cover the Drainage Holes: Place a piece of mesh, broken pottery shard, or landscape fabric over the drainage holes to prevent soil from washing out.
  2. Add a Layer of Drainage Material (Optional): Some gardeners add a layer of gravel or small rocks at the bottom of the pot to improve drainage. However, this is not always necessary, as the potting mix should provide adequate drainage on its own.

Adding Potting Mix: Creating the Right Environment

Once the pot is prepared, it’s time to add the potting mix. Proper soil preparation is key to plant health.

  1. Add Potting Mix: Fill the pot with potting mix, leaving enough space for the plant’s root ball.
  2. Gently Tap the Pot: Tap the pot gently to settle the soil and eliminate air pockets.

Planting Your Plant: The Right Technique

Now, it’s time to plant your plant! Proper planting ensures your plant establishes well.

  1. Remove the Plant from Its Original Container: Gently remove the plant from its original container. If the roots are tightly packed, gently loosen them with your fingers.
  2. Position the Plant: Place the plant in the center of the pot, ensuring the top of the root ball is level with the soil surface.
  3. Fill in Around the Roots: Fill in the space around the roots with potting mix, gently firming the soil.
  4. Water Thoroughly: Water the plant thoroughly after planting to settle the soil and encourage root growth.

Watering After Planting: Establishing Your Plant

  1. Water Deeply: Water the plant thoroughly after planting, ensuring the water drains out of the drainage holes.
  2. Monitor Soil Moisture: Check the soil moisture regularly. Water when the top inch or two of soil feels dry to the touch.
  3. Adjust Watering Frequency: Adjust the watering frequency based on the plant’s needs, the weather conditions, and the type of pot.

How Often to Water: Finding the Right Balance

The frequency of watering depends on several factors, including the plant’s species, the pot material, the weather, and the growing environment. Understanding these factors will help you find the right balance.

  • Plant Species: Different plants have different water requirements. Research the specific needs of your plants.
  • Pot Material: Terracotta pots dry out faster than plastic pots, requiring more frequent watering.
  • Weather Conditions: Plants need more water during hot, dry weather and less during cooler, wetter periods.
  • Growing Environment: Plants indoors generally require less watering than plants outdoors.
  • Soil Moisture: Check the soil moisture regularly by inserting your finger into the soil. Water when the top inch or two of soil feels dry to the touch.

Methods of Watering: Choosing the Best Approach

There are several methods of watering potted plants, each with its own advantages and disadvantages. Choosing the best approach can make watering more efficient and effective.

  • Top Watering: This involves watering the plant from the top, allowing the water to drain through the soil and out of the drainage holes. This is the most common method and is suitable for most plants.
  • Bottom Watering: This involves placing the pot in a saucer or tray of water and allowing the soil to absorb water from the bottom. This is useful for plants that prefer to be watered from the bottom, such as African violets.
  • Self-Watering Pots: Self-watering pots have a reservoir that holds water, which is then drawn up into the soil as needed. These are convenient for plants that require consistent moisture.

Signs of Overwatering and Underwatering: Recognizing the Problems

Knowing the signs of overwatering and underwatering is crucial for adjusting your watering habits and preventing damage to your plants. Recognizing the signs allows for quick adjustments.

  • Overwatering: Signs of overwatering include yellowing leaves, wilting, and soggy soil. The roots may also begin to rot.
  • Underwatering: Signs of underwatering include wilting leaves, dry soil, and stunted growth.

Addressing Common Watering Issues: Troubleshooting Tips

Even with the best intentions, watering issues can arise. Knowing how to address common problems can save your plants. These troubleshooting tips will help you keep your plants healthy.

  • Yellowing Leaves: Yellowing leaves can be a sign of both overwatering and underwatering. Check the soil moisture to determine the cause and adjust your watering accordingly.
  • Wilting Leaves: Wilting leaves can also be a sign of both overwatering and underwatering. Again, check the soil moisture. If the soil is dry, water the plant. If the soil is soggy, allow the soil to dry out.
  • Brown Leaf Tips: Brown leaf tips are often a sign of underwatering or low humidity. Increase watering or mist the plant regularly.

Repotting Your Plants: Providing More Space

As your plants grow, they will eventually outgrow their pots. Repotting provides more space for the roots to grow. Knowing when to repot is important.

  • Signs of Needing Repotting: Signs that a plant needs repotting include roots circling the pot, roots growing out of the drainage holes, and stunted growth.
  • Repotting Process: When repotting, choose a pot that is a few inches larger than the current pot. Gently remove the plant from its pot, loosen the roots, and plant it in the new pot with fresh potting mix.
  • Timing: Repotting is best done during the plant’s growing season.

Root Rot: Causes, Symptoms, and Solutions

Root rot is a common and serious problem in potted plants. It’s often caused by overwatering and poor drainage. Early detection is key.

  • Causes: Overwatering, poor drainage, and compacted soil are the main causes.
  • Symptoms: Symptoms include yellowing leaves, wilting, stunted growth, and a foul odor.
  • Solutions: If you suspect root rot, stop watering and allow the soil to dry out. You may need to repot the plant with fresh potting mix. Prune away any affected roots.
